Rhodes v. McDonald
, 670 F. Supp. 2d 1363, 1365 (USDC MD GA, 2009), Judge Clay Land wrote this
of plaintiff‘s attorney:
When a lawyer files complaints and motions without a reasonable basis for believing that they aresupported by existing law or a modification or extension of existing law, that lawyer abuses her privilege to practice law. When a lawyer uses the courts as a platform for political agendadisconnected from any legitimate legal cause of action, that lawyer abuses her privilege to practicelaw
….
As a national leader in the so-
called ‘birther movement,’ Plaintiff’s counsel has attempted to uselitigation to provide the ‘legal foundation’ for her political agenda. She seeks to use the Court’s
power to compel dis
covery in her efforts force the President to produce a ‘birth certificate’ that is
satisfactory to herself and her followers
.‖ 670 F. Supp. 2d at 1366.

is by law not within its authority. See, for example,
Flint River Mills v. Henry
, 234 Ga. 385, 216 S.E.2d 895 (1975); Ga. Comp. R. & Regs. r. 616-1-2-.22(3).The Secretary of State should withdraw the hearing request as being improvidently issued. A referringagency may withdraw the request at any time. Ga. Comp. R. & Regs. r. 616-1-2-.17(1). Indeed,regardless of the collapse of proceedings before the ALJ, the original hearing request was defective as amatter of law.
Terry v. Handel
, 08cv158774S (Superior Court Fulton County, 2008),
appeal dismissed
,No. S09D0284 (Ga. Supreme Court),
reconsideration denied
, No. S09A1373.
(―The Secretary of State of
Georgia is not given any authority that is discretionary nor any that is mandatory to refuse to allowsomeone to be listed as a candidate for President by a political party because she believes that the
candidate might not be qualified.‖) Similarly, no law gives
the Secretary of State authority to determinethe qualifications of someone named by a political party to be on the Presidential Preference Primaryballot. Your duty is determined by the statutory requirement that the Executive Committee of a politicalparty name presidential preference primary candidates. O.C.G.A. § 21-2-193. Consequently, the attemptto hold hearings on qualifications which you may not enforce is
ultra vires
